When you use E+R=O*, don’t weigh yourself down looking for the right response. Focus instead on eliminating a low-value response and acting on a high-value response. 

There isn’t a correct response you should do. There are responses that add value and ones that don’t, responses that raise standards and ones that don’t, responses that move you forward and ones that don’t.

Embrace the chase Do the work.

*Event + Response = Outcome
